Nicole Fantelli, MSN, RN, NE-BC, MRMC, Chief Executive Officer
Nicole brings 16 years of healthcare experience to her role as Chief Executive Officer of Summa Rehab Hospital, including business development, sales management, utilization review, and operational performance. She recently served as regional vice president of business development for a national post-acute healthcare organization and held several leadership roles within Cleveland Clinic Rehabilitation Hospitals.
Nicole began her career as a registered nurse, giving her a deep understanding of both patient care and healthcare operations. She earned a bachelor’s degree in nursing from Ohio University in Athens, Ohio, and a master’s degree in nursing from Chamberlain University. She also holds the Nurse Executive Certification from the American Nurses Credentialing Center and the Medical Rehabilitation Management Certification from the American Medical Rehabilitation Providers Association.
When not at work, Nicole enjoys spending time with her husband and three sons, being outdoors, traveling, and reading.
Dr. Jeffrey Sanderson M.D., FAAPMR, Medical Director
Dr Sanderson has over 20 years of experience in outpatient and inpatient hospital PM&R patient care. He has been the Medical Director at Summa Rehab Hospital since its opening in 2012. He now exclusively devotes his time to providing inpatient medical care for his patients and is passionate about helping them achieve their optimal functional independence and quality of life.
A lifelong Ohio native, Dr. Sanderson grew up in Northeast Ohio and completed his bachelor’s degree at the University of Cincinnati. While in undergraduate studies, he also became an EMT on a life squad to help prepare him for his ultimate goal of becoming a physician. He is a proud Buckeye, as he graduated from The Ohio State University College of Medicine. Dr Sanderson completed a year Preliminary Internal Medicine Internship at Riverside Methodist Hospital Ohio Health and stayed at OSU for his subsequent 3 year residency in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ation. He is board certified in PM&R and is a Fellow of the American Academy of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ation.
Dr Sanderson resides in the Akron area with his wife and is most proud of his 3 children. He enjoys many outdoor activities and most avidly loves skiing.
Dr. Brandon Weeks, MD., Associate Medical Director
Brandon D. Weeks M.D. is a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ation (PM&R) Doctor at Summa Rehabilitation Hospital. He is also currently Medical Staff President and Associate Medical Director. He specializes in the diagnosis and management of adult neuromuscular disorders, their impact on a patient’s life, and recovery/improvement of quality of life. Dr. Weeks also served as Medical Director of Hillside Rehabilitation Hospital and ran their Electromyography/Nerve Conduction Study (EMG/NCS) lab from 2017 until early 2022. Prior to that, he was in private practice in the Akron area where he was a PM&R medical staff member at Summa Rehabilitation Hospital, Edwin Shaw Rehabilitation Hospital, and covered the EMG/NCS lab at Akron General Hospital.
He is a member of AAPMR and maintains his board certification with ABPMR.
Dr. Weeks grew up locally in Kent, Ohio. He completed his medical school training at NEOUCOM (now NEOMED) in Rootstown, Ohio in 2008. He then went on to complete an intern year and residency training at The Ohio State University in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ation in 2012.
Dr. Weeks enjoys spending time with his family, the outdoors, and biking.

Sharon Souliere, BSN, RN, CCM, Director of Patient Outcomes
Licensed as a RN since 1981 in the state of Ohio. Obtained BSN from Walsh University- Canton, Ohio 1991. Certified in Case Management since 2017.
Initially worked in acute hospital setting at Timken Mercy Hospital in Canton, Ohio- 1981-1991. Worked Medical-Surgical units, Acute Rehabilitation as charge nurse, and Oncology unit.
1991-1997- Worked VNS-Hospice – as RN, in direct patient care for 4 yrs. Developed and managed the admissions team, while taking on the role as hospital and community Liaison. Developed the 1st Hospice care program in collaboration with Skilled nursing facilities in Stark County, Ohio in 1995. Provided Hospice education, and pain management education to the skilled facilities. Started with 6 facilities, grew within 1 year to 12 facilities able to provide care and support to hospice patients throughout the community.
1997-2000- Case manager – on a 36 bed, medical unit, in an acute care hospital, taking care of discharge plans and utilization reviews.
2000-2007- Worked at Summa Care Insurance company as a case manager and utilization review nurse for admissions and continued stays to skilled nursing, rehabilitation and LTAC facilities. Worked with skilled nursing facilities in the Summa Care network, on-sight to attend conferences, meet with clients and along with the facility, plan safe discharges to home, while assessing needs for continued stay.
2007-2017- Manager of Case Management and Utilization review at Summa Western Reserve Hospital. Responsible for utilization review, Commercial plans, Medicare/Medicaid programs-Including all audits and appeals. Managed team of 12 for Discharge plans and utilization review.
2017- present – Director of Patient Outcomes at Summa Rehab Hospital.
